Released in 2008, A Quiet Little Marriage is a drame film directed by Mo Perkins, running about 90 minutes. “You call it madness, but they call it love.” — that tagline sets the tone.

What it’s about. A Quiet Little Marriage is the love story of Dax and Olive, who manage to find harmony even as they juggle family, romance and intimacy, but that all changes the night she asks him for a baby. Writer/director Mo Perkins’ intense and profound, raw feature debut is laced with sly humor, exquisitely rendered characters, and a pitch-perfect emotional honesty.

Who’s in it. A Quiet Little Marriage stars Cy Carter as Dax, Mary Elizabeth Ellis as Olive, Jimmi Simpson as Jackson and Michael O'Neill as Bruce, among others.
